Outstanding official prep materials from LSAT

The LSAT is sufficiently idiosyncratic in both the form and substance of its content that studying with anything other than the official, exams released by the LSAT board (LSAC) runs the risk of doing more harm than good. The problem with such advice until recently is that before the release of this book a couple of years ago, none of the official materials provided anything more than an answer key, which could leave you scratching your head about why you got something wrong or how you were supposed to get to the correct answer to begin with. By supplying complete and generally pretty decent explanations for all the questions in the three exams included in this book, as well as providing a useful prefatory section giving specific test taking tips for each section, this book is extremely valuable and I might add long overdue. To be fully prepared, you will probably want to use this book and perhaps one or more of the LSAC's "10 Actual, Official LSAT Prep Tests." If you need extra help on the "games" section (and most people do), you may also wish to purchase the Powerscore LSAT Logic Games Bible, which alone among the non-official LSAT prep books uses actual LSAT questions obtained under license from the LSAC. It should be noted, however, that the LSAT Superprep book also includes strategy tips as well is very good explanations for the LSAT games section, making the once mandatory purchase of the Powerscore Bible optional for some test takers.

not super, but quite adequate

...for reviewing mistakes. the explanations of the correct answers are not written in the most accessible english, but i've found them good enough for explaining the inevitable (for me) bonehead mistakes. my prep work, with a month to go, has consisted of the two powerscore bibles (very good), plenty of official prep tests, and this superprep. since there are only three tests in here, plus a small "how to" section, i took one when i started studying to gauge my weak spots; a second one when i felt my brain was swimming in too much powerscore bible tactical info; and the third is waiting for a week before the test.

all in all, worth the money, but supplement with the 10-test books.
